Where: Oakview Cemetery, 1032 N Main St, Royal Oak, MI 48067
When: Sunday, June 2, 2024, at 3:00 PM
Why The Salvation Army has a Memorial Service: This traditional service gives all an opportunity to pause, reflect, and rejoice in God's faithfulness to us, and to those whose lives we are honoring.
What to Bring: Your family and a chair. In the event of inclement weather, the service will be held at the Royal Oak Salvation Army, located at N. 3015 Main Street, Royal Oak, Michigan. What to Expect: The Salvation Army brass band will begin to play at 2:30 PM. Many sit near the gravesite of their loved ones who are interred there, or with friends of family they know. The names of soldiers who have been Promoted to Glory since the last service will be read aloud. There will be a couple of congregational songs, and a brief devotional, followed by the playing of taps.
